How they compare
Italy currently reports 46.01 million Number against 39.93 million Number in Poland, a difference of 6.08 million Number.
That makes Italy's figure about 1.2 times Poland's.
Across all 18 years both countries report, Italy has been ahead every year.
Italy ranks 6th and Poland ranks 7th of 35 countries.
Italy has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Italy | Poland |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 66.08 million Number | 30.05 million Number | 36.03 million Number | Italy |
| 2010s | 57.13 million Number | 41.29 million Number | 15.84 million Number | Italy |
| 2020s | 46.01 million Number | 34.53 million Number | 11.48 million Number | Italy |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
